The token-bucket refill here in Gatewright is hardcoded, which made the Oakhurst load test awkward — we had to redeploy to change limits. Please move these into the config map so future maintainers can tune per-route limits without a build. Also note the burst ceiling interacts with the retry header logic. Current effective values are as follows.

tuning constants:
QUOTAS = {
    "druwyn": 5,
    "holix": 5,
    "zorath": 5,
    "holwyn": 10,
}

**Ticket: Config drift on Pushloom fan-out workers**

The backpressure settings on the notification fan-out tier have drifted from what's in the Gantry repo. Three workers in the Ostwick pool are running a higher concurrency cap and a shorter shed threshold than declared, which explains the uneven queue depths new folks keep asking about. Do not hand-edit the nodes; fix the repo or redeploy. For reference while triaging, the declared (intended) configuration is as follows.

config for yajep-tafof:
[rusath]
team = julmir
access_code = ac_fe37fd
host = rusath.novactech.test
port = 8000
owner = pelmir.weneth
peer = oliwyn.olvarqdyn.internal

## SproutTimer Environments

SproutTimer runs three environments: dev, staging, and prod. Each schedules watering jobs against its own device fleet; staging uses simulated valves only. Secrets are injected at deploy time and never stored in the repo. Network egress is restricted to the device broker. For review purposes, the staging environment currently runs with the following settings.

deployment values, kajep-kageg:
[praix]
host = praix.paliqcorp.corp
user = praix_svc
database = praix_prod

Q: How do I open the interview room on Level 2?
A: Room 2C at Halvorsen House is reserved for candidate interviews only. Book through the Veldtra scheduler, minimum one hour ahead. Blinds stay down during sessions. No food. Escort candidates in and out; they must not be left alone inside. The keypad beside the door takes the current pass code, which is below.

staff pass of kawip-hawef = bdg-QLP-2